How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Venetian Islands?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Venetian Islands Studio Apartments | $2,572 | $1,550 | $8,070 |
| Venetian Islands 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,341 | $1,650 | $10,000+ |
| Venetian Islands 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,602 | $2,199 | $10,000+ |
| Venetian Islands 3 Bedroom Apartments | $7,111 | $3,800 | $10,000+ |
| Venetian Islands 4 Bedroom Apartments | $16,923 | $5,750 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Venetian Islands
How much are Studio apartments in Venetian Islands?
There are currently 577 Studio Apartments in Venetian Islands with rent ranges from $1,550 to $8,070 with an average price of $2,572.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Venetian Islands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Venetian Islands ranges from $1,650 to $11,342 with an average monthly rent of $3,341.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Venetian Islands c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Venetian Islands range from $2,199 to $10,224.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,602.
How expensive are Venetian Islands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 117 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Venetian Islands on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$3,800 to $25,970 - averaging $7,111 for the location.
